What are AI visibility tools and why do you need one?
AI visibility tools track how your brand appears in responses from ChatGPT, Perplexity, Claude, Google AI Overviews, and other AI search engines. Unlike traditional SEO tools that monitor Google rankings, these platforms answer a different question: when someone asks an AI model about your industry, does it mention your brand?
The shift matters because search behavior is changing. Millions of users now ask ChatGPT or Perplexity instead of Googling. If your brand isn't cited in those AI responses, you're invisible to a growing segment of your audience.
Traditional SEO metrics -- keyword rankings, backlinks, domain authority -- don't tell you anything about AI visibility. You need specialized tools that actually query AI models, analyze the responses, and track which brands get mentioned.

How AI visibility tracking actually works
These platforms query AI models with prompts relevant to your industry, then parse the responses to detect brand mentions. The process looks like this:
- You define a list of prompts ("best project management software", "how to improve team collaboration", etc.)
- The tool submits each prompt to ChatGPT, Perplexity, Claude, Gemini, and other models
- It analyzes the AI-generated responses to find brand mentions, citations, and recommendations
- Results appear in a dashboard showing visibility scores, mention frequency, and competitive positioning
Some platforms run prompts manually on a schedule. Others use APIs where available. The best tools track 8-10+ AI models and refresh data daily or weekly.

Crawler log tracking
AI models crawl your website to gather information. Crawler logs show which pages ChatGPT, Claude, and Perplexity are reading, how often they return, and any errors they encounter.
This is critical for diagnosing indexing issues. If AI models can't access your content, you won't get cited. Very few platforms offer crawler log tracking -- Promptwatch does, most competitors don't.

Getting started with AI visibility tracking
Most platforms offer free trials. Start with:
- Define your core prompts: List 20-50 questions your customers ask that should mention your brand
- Run a baseline audit: See where you currently appear across AI models
- Identify the biggest gaps: Which high-volume prompts mention competitors but not you?
- Create targeted content: Write or generate articles that fill those gaps
- Track improvements: Monitor visibility scores as AI models start citing your new content
